Job Description
---
The Education Abroad team invites you to apply for student employment as part of our Student Engagement Team. The mission of the Student Engagement Team is to create an open atmosphere to welcome visitors to our front office, as well as provide aid in recruitment to our study abroad programs which will also include peer advising.
Student Assistants provide customer service to students and faculty interested in study abroad, and they also assist Education Abroad staff with internal office projects. Peer Advising will be an additional role our office will assign.
You will also help run the front office through clerical maintenance and assist in recruitment through events, peer advising, and presentations.
Responsibilities Include:
- Greeting visitors and answering general questions pertaining to Education Abroad
- Contributing to a welcoming and inclusive study abroad advising process
- Preparing and maintaining organized files and packets or meeting materials
- Assist peers with answering questions about Education Abroad programs, scholarships, and procedures
- Receiving and processing incoming and outgoing mail, both hard copy and the central Education Abroad email account
- Facilitate presentation about the OU study abroad process and available programs
- Lead group advising session on various OU study abroad programs
- 1-1 advising peers on study abroad programs
- Public speaking, including presenting the Study Abroad 101 regularly across campus in-person and through zoom
- Assist Education Abroad professional staff with job function including management of application materials, data entry, student orientation, recruitment, advising, and other projects as assigned
